Ticket: Connection failures after user-module split

Heads up for the release train — since we carved the user module out of the Bramblecore monolith, the new userkeep service keeps dropping connections under load. Looks like the pool size got copied from the monolith config, which is way too big for the smaller instance. We've trimmed it in staging and errors dropped to zero. Want a sign-off before Friday's cut. To reproduce against staging, use the connection string below.

replica DSN, kajep-yahag: mssql://praok_svc:iF@db-8d68.plorvaio.local:5432/eliion

Internal Memo — Capacity Decision, Norbeck Plant

Heads of department: following the review, we will not expand the Norbeck plant this year. Line three will instead run a second shift from October, covering forecast demand for the Calder series. Procurement and HR should plan accordingly; capex requests tied to expansion are paused. The confidential note on longer-term plans is set out below.

confidential, kagep-kahof: Druokax Systems plans to lower the Ulaath list price by 53 percent in March.

Alert: DonationReceiptMailerBacklog. This fires when the Givewell-Pines receipt mailer queue in the Tandemleaf platform exceeds 2,000 unsent receipts for more than 15 minutes. Donors expect receipts within the hour, so Finance treats this as customer-impacting. Common causes are SMTP relay throttling and template rendering failures after a schema change. First responders should check worker health, then the relay status board, and escalate to the Messaging squad if the backlog keeps growing. Full triage steps live on the internal page below.

operations page: https://jenkins.zemvarcloud.local/job/merge_requests/repo/build/73930b4b30f0a8ed

**09:14 — Incremental rebuilds stall.** Heads up: Pagecrumb's incremental static rebuild queue jammed after a template change touched every page, so "incremental" quietly became "full rebuild, forever." Marisol flushed the queue at 09:41 and things recovered. Release manager: please hold the next cut until we confirm. The stuck build's trace token is noted just below.

trace token, kawip-fafog: htk14_26e64c4d35154e